Detailed explanation-2: -The waterfall model is a sequential design process in which progress is seen as flowing steadily downwards (like a waterfall) through the phases of Conception, Initiation, Analysis, Design, Construction, Testing, Production/Implementation, and Maintenance.

Detailed explanation-3: -In Waterfall, the testing phase happens after the building phase. This means clients must be concise and clear on requirements before development begins. Once the project begins, there cannot be any changes made. Other phases of development, like design or testing, have to be complete once in Waterfall as well.

Detailed explanation-4: -The waterfall model and software development life cycle have six stages: requirements, analysis, design, coding, testing, and deployment.
